If you don't know the story Ken Miles who drove the Ford GT had a chance to win the all 3 endurance races. (Daytona, Sebring and LeMans) After winning the first 2 he had a considrable lead at LeMans with his Ford Team mates in 2nd and 3rd.

Ownership wanted to get a pictrure of all 3 Fords crossing the line together. Miles slowed to let the others catch up. Bruce McClaren was driving one of the other cars. McClaren guns it and crosses the line first robbing Miles of the win.

Miles is killed in an accident at Riverside a few months later.
